Jerry Smith got a new dog from the animal shelter. Named him Bandit. Jerry’s story is a sad one, but it did end on a happy note.

He recently lost his old time friend, his precious dog, to health problems. Jerry is like us and so many animal lovers, his dogs are his whole life. Well, when Pebbles passed away a few weeks ago, his other dog named Rosy stopped eating and just sat in the corner. Nothing Jerry did, walks, played, talked to Rosy, could snap her out of the sorrow of losing her best friend. Rosy had no desire to live, she stopped eating, only to nibble on very few bits here and there. The doctor told Jerry that Rosy wouldn’t make it if she didn’t start eating.

As much pain that Jerry felt in losing Pebbles, he hardly could bare to get another dog. He realized he had to do it for Rosy, he had to save Rosy’s life! So, Jerry took Rosy to the animal shelter and let her visit with different dogs. She seem to take a liking to the boy dog. He was frisky and full of vinegar. Jerry brought him home and named him Bandit. Guess what, by the 2nd day Rosy started to eat again. She started showing Bandit around the house, she now seems to have another reason to live. He says that Rosy acts like a big sister to Bandit.

The pain of losing a pet is unbearable. You always say you will never put yourself through such pain again… but you know what… if you are an animal lover, you just can’t live without them. You are a good man Jerry!
